Grafana's K6 service experienced sporadic DNS issues from April 9-15 that caused cloud test runs to occasionally fail to start and abort. The problem was traced to a flaky DNS server that was causing random test initialization failures. The engineering team deployed a fix to resolve the DNS server issues and confirmed full resolution after monitoring the system.
